Infrastructure Automation
Provisioning Automation
- Terraform infrastructure builds
- Modular Infrastructure-as-Code design
- Multi-environment provisioning (dev/stage/prod)
- Immutable infrastructure patterns
- Automated environment replication
Configuration Management
- Ansible-based configuration
- Idempotent deployment strategies
- Server baseline enforcement
- Drift detection & remediation
- Secure secrets integration
CI/CD Engineering
- Git-based workflow design
- Branch strategy modeling
- Automated build pipelines
- Artifact management
- Zero-downtime deployment pipelines
- Blue/Green deployment strategy
- Canary release engineering
- Rollback automation
Shell & Systems Scripting
Advanced Bash, POSIX SH & Perl Engineering
- Production-grade Bash scripting
- Portable POSIX-compliant shell scripting
- High-performance Perl automation
- Modular script frameworks
- Robust error handling & structured logging
- Lockfile & concurrency control mechanisms
- Parallelized task execution
- Cross-platform (FreeBSD/Linux) compatibility
Unix Toolchain Mastery
- AWK, sed, grep data processing pipelines
- Log parsing automation
- Performance reporting scripts
- Backup validation scripts
- Certificate lifecycle automation
Cross-Platform Portability
- FreeBSD to Linux compatible scripting
- Environment-aware scripting logic
- Secure cron orchestration
- Scheduled job fleet management
Application Deployment Automation
- Automated Nginx & reverse proxy configuration
- PHP-FPM pool automation
- Database migration scripting
- API deployment orchestration
- Worker/queue deployment automation
- Container deployment automation
- SSL certificate automation
- Domain provisioning automation
Monitoring & Self-Healing Systems
- Automated health checks
- Monit-based action triggers
- Self-healing service restarts
- Disk growth monitoring automation
- Database growth tracking automation
- Log anomaly detection scripting
- Auto-remediation workflows
Database Automation
- MySQL replication setup automation
- Backup & restore automation
- Partition management scripts
- Slow query analysis automation
- Storage growth tracking
- Binary log management automation
Security Automation
- Automated IP blocking systems
- Abuse detection frameworks
- Firewall rule automation
- SSH key lifecycle automation
- Compliance verification scripts
- Patch rollout automation
Reporting & Operational Intelligence
- Monthly infrastructure reports
- Disk utilization reports
- Database growth reports
- Cost reporting automation
- SLA reporting dashboards
- Executive summary generation scripts
Workflow Engineering
- Cross-system orchestration
- Event-driven automation
- Webhook-based triggers
- Scheduled task pipelines
- API integration scripting
- Third-party SaaS automation
- Spreadsheet automation (Google Sheets scripting)
- Notification system integration
DevOps Culture & Process Design
- Deployment workflow standardization
- Change management automation
- Runbook automation
- On-call support automation
- Audit trail integration
- Version-controlled infrastructure policy
We do not just write scripts. We engineer automation ecosystems.
From infrastructure provisioning to self-healing systems and executive-level reporting, our DevOps automation reduces operational overhead, increases reliability, and gives organizations back control over their infrastructure.
Frequently Asked Questions
What automation tools and frameworks do you use?
We work with Terraform for infrastructure provisioning, Ansible for configuration management, and build custom CI/CD pipelines using tools appropriate to your stack. We also write production-grade shell scripts in Bash, POSIX sh, Python, and Perl.
Can you set up CI/CD pipelines for my existing team?
Yes. We design and implement CI/CD pipelines tailored to your development workflow, including automated testing, staging environments, and zero-downtime production deployments. We also train your team on the new processes.
What does zero-downtime deployment mean?
Zero-downtime deployment means pushing new code or configuration changes to production without any interruption to your users. We achieve this through techniques like blue-green deployments, rolling updates, and health-check-gated rollouts.
Do you work with containerized environments?
Yes. We work with Docker, Kubernetes, and FreeBSD jails for container orchestration. We design container strategies that balance operational simplicity with the isolation and portability benefits of containerization.
Can you automate our existing manual processes?
That is one of our core specialties. We audit your current operational workflows, identify repetitive or error-prone manual tasks, and build automation that reduces toil while improving reliability and consistency.